Motor vehicle accident near Sandridge Rd and post officeWashington County OH

audio iconTraffic
Sandridge Rd, Ohio 45786

A motor vehicle accident occurred near Sandridge Road and the post office on Route 681. Emergency responders are on scene managing traffic and attending to the situation. Additional fire trucks were requested to assist with traffic control. The accident involved a Honda Civic and occurred on a hill before Sandridge Road. There was some smoke reported at the scene, but no further details on injuries were provided.
